About 03 Numbers
Numerous organizations utilize 03 numbers instead of the more costly 08 numbers. As an example, numerous public sector organizations have transitioned from 0845 numbers to 0345. The cost of calls matches calls to geographic numbers (01 or 02). Call charges depend on the time of the day, and most providers provide call packages that permit calls free of charge during certain times of the day. Mobile call costs differ according to the selected calling plan. Generally, these calls are included in free call packages.
